Query 1: Does this yarn’s coloration fade after washing?

This yarn is understood for its colorfastness. Correct washing and drying in keeping with care directions sometimes minimizes fading. Nevertheless, some slight coloration bleeding would possibly happen in the course of the preliminary wash, particularly with darker shades. Pre-washing is really helpful, particularly for initiatives involving a number of colours.

Query 6: How can one guarantee coloration consistency throughout a number of skeins for big initiatives?

Buying skeins with the identical dye lot quantity is essential for guaranteeing coloration consistency. Dye lot data is usually printed on the yarn label. If a number of skeins with the identical dye lot are unavailable, alternating skeins each few rows will help distribute any slight coloration variations extra evenly all through the challenge.

Tip 4: Dye Lot Consciousness

Sustaining coloration consistency throughout a number of skeins necessitates consideration to dye lot numbers. Buying skeins with equivalent dye lot numbers ensures coloration uniformity all through the challenge. When dye heaps differ, alternating skeins each few rows will help distribute refined coloration variations extra evenly.
